There were many requirements for laying the Five Emperors Coins on the threshold. The first was the choice of the Five Emperor Coins. The Five Emperor Coins were divided into the Small Five Emperor Coins (ancient coins cast during the reign of Shunzhi, Kangxi, Yongzheng, Qianlong, and Jiaqing) and the Big Five Emperor Coins (coins from the times of Qin Shihuang, Han Wudi, Tang Taizong, Song Taizu, and Ming Chengzu). In modern times, the Five Emperor Coins usually referred to the Small Five Emperor Coins. The source of the Five Emperor Coins had to be formal and should be purchased through formal professional channels. It should be avoided from the black market or private traffickers because the Five Emperor Coins from these sources might be contaminated with filthy Qi and heavy Yin Qi, making them unsuitable for use. The second was the order of placement. When the small Five Emperors Coins were placed under the threshold stone, the order from left to right should be Shunzhi, Kangxi, Yongzheng, Qianlong and Jiaqing. From the outside of the door, it should be Shunkang, Yongqian, Jiazhi, Xizheng and Longqing. When placed inside the door, the head of the word faced the door and the foot of the word faced inward (the left side of the Ming and Qing Dynasties was respected). If the coins were placed in the wrong order according to their age, the Five Emperor Coins would not be able to play the role of Feng Shui. Instead, it might affect the Feng Shui of the home. The order of the Great Five Emperor Coins was placed outside the door. From left to right, they were Qin Banliang Coin, Han Wuzhu Coin, Kaiyuan Tongbao Coin, Song Yuan Tongbao Coin, and Yongle Tongbao Coin. Then, he placed the Five Emperor Coins in the right direction. The side with the words had to be on top. In addition, there were other taboos when burying the Five Emperor Coins under the threshold. Don't place items that clash with the Five Emperor Coins beside the threshold, such as stone lions or peach wood ornaments. Otherwise, the Five Emperor Coins won't work and will cause chaos in the home. The time to bury the Five Emperor Coins was also particular. It could not be buried on rainy days or windy days. The first and fifteenth days of the lunar calendar were also not suitable. It was best to choose an auspicious day. Also, when betting on the "Five Emperor Coins," he had to give the renovation workers an extra red packet with an even amount and buy them two packs of cigarettes.
